The PD” Conditioned Power Distribution Series easily
deals with normal AC line power fluctuations, as well as
the more drastic abnormalities of the spike and surge
variety. Also, filtering of airborne interferences caused by
electromagnetic and radio frequency
transmissions is routinely accomplished.
More sophisticated ETA models utilize
microprocessor technology to regulate
AC power and sequence power turn-on
reducing high in-rushes of power.
